What Is Switch Outlet Installation?
Switch outlet installation refers to the process of adding, replacing, or upgrading electrical switches and outlets throughout a home or business space. At its most straightforward level, an outlet provides an interface between your home's wiring and the appliances you connect. A switch, by definition, controls the flow of electricity to a connected device by engaging or disengaging the circuit.
Mechanically, each installation traces back to your home's electrical panel, where circuits are protected to different parts of the house. During switch outlet installation, a licensed electrician routes cables through walls to the target location, secures the device in a correctly sized electrical box, and makes the electrical connections to standard. Grounding, load balancing, and conduit requirements all play a role in a safe and lasting installation.
Modern switch outlet installation now covers a wide range of device types — tamper-resistant receptacles, smart switches, 15-amp standard receptacles, and more. All of these has distinct code considerations that differ from standard work, which is why licensed electrician involvement is always recommended.

The Switch Outlet Installation Procedure Step by Step
-
Home Walkthrough and Needs Review
Before any work begins, our technicians walk through your home to understand the scope. We examine your existing panel capacity and discuss your goals so we can plan the installation before the first outlet is opened.
-
Electrical Load Analysis
Understanding which breakers will feed the new outlets matters a great deal. Our electricians verify circuit capacity to keep the system balanced. This step prevents future problems.
-
Power Disconnection and Safety Prep
Safety comes first at Reed Electrical Services, LLC. We turn off the correct breaker and verify with a voltage tester to protect everyone on site. This step avoids injury.
-
Cable Routing and Hardware Mounting
This is where the physical installation happens. Our technicians route conductors to the location and install properly rated enclosures at the proper depth. All terminations is made with correct wire gauge and technique.
-
Making the Final Electrical Connections
With boxes in place, the switches or outlets are wired to the terminals. Line, load, and ground wires are correctly attached using appropriate connectors to prevent loose connections.
-
Powering Up and Confirming Function
With everything hooked up, our professionals energize the installation and test every outlet and switch using outlet testers. We check polarity to make sure the installation passes.

Switch Outlet Installation Frequently Asked Questions
How long does switch outlet installation usually require?
Most standard switch outlet installation projects take between one and three hours depending on the complexity of the wiring. Multi-room installations may take longer depending on scope. Our team will share an honest project duration before any work begins.
How much does switch outlet installation usually run?
Pricing for switch outlet installation depends on how complex the job is, if the panel needs upgrades, and inspection fees. Standard receptacle installs usually fall in a modest price range, while larger multi-circuit projects cost more. Contact our office for a personalized pricing review.
Is switch outlet installation a good weekend project?
While some homeowners attempt to handle switch outlet installation on their own, the dangers are significant. Loose connections lead to arcing — all of which can harm your family. Certified professionals carry proper licensing and ensure the work passes inspection.
Do I need a permit for switch outlet installation in Palos Hills?
In most cases, switch outlet installation that adds wiring to the panel will need a permit pulled. Swapping like-for-like outlets are sometimes exempt. Our team handles all code compliance filings on your behalf so there's nothing for you to do.
How long do switch outlet installation improvements remain effective?
Properly wired switches and outlets are designed to serve several decades when not physically damaged. Outlets in high-use areas can wear down faster and should be inspected periodically. We can check your switches during a follow-up appointment.
